Nissan Gravite Launched In India

Nissan Motor India has announced the launch of the All-New Nissan Gravite at an attractive introductory price of INR 5.65 lakhs. A bold and game-changing 7-seater MPV, the Gravite marks the beginning of a new chapter in Nissan’s India journey.

The Gravite is the first product to roll out under Nissan Motor India’s renewed product offensive — underlining the company’s strengthened commitment and presence in India.

The All-New Nissan Gravite establishes a distinct and confident identity aligned with Nissan’s global design language. Its elevated proportions, muscular body lines, pronounced wheel arches and high ground clearance create a commanding road presence suited to diverse Indian driving conditions.

The Gravite is the only vehicle in its segment to feature distinctive hood branding along with unique rear-door badging — a bold design expression that reinforces exclusivity and strong visual recall.

Central to its identity is Nissan’s signature C-shaped design integration at the front and rear, ensuring instant brand recognition while delivering a premium, contemporary character.

The Nissan Gravite redefines family mobility with exceptional cabin roominess and pioneering modularity. Designed to seamlessly adapt to daily commutes and long journeys alike, it delivers intuitive comfort across all three rows.

Premium suede and leatherette quilted seats enhance seating comfort, while generous shoulder and elbow room in the first row and ample headroom and knee room in the second and third rows ensure relaxed seating for all occupants.

Safety remains a core pillar of the Gravite’s value proposition, with 30+ standard safety features designed to deliver peace of mind for families.

The All-New Gravite as the second critical model in Nissan’s rejuvenated portfolio represents a decisive step in the brand’s product renaissance in India. Building on the momentum of the New Nissan Magnite – which is exported from India to markets and locally supported by an expanding dealer network across network cities, the Gravite establishes a strong foundation for sustained growth.

With the upcoming Tekton C-SUV in mid-2026 and a 7-seater C-SUV in early 2027, Nissan’s future-ready roadmap signals a confident multi-segment offensive in the Indian market.

The All-New Nissan GRAVITE is launched at an attractive introductory price of INR 5.65 Lakhs.

VariantEX Showroom (INR, Lakhs)
VISIA5,65,000
ACENTA6,59,000
N-CONNECTA7,20,000
TEKNA7,91,000
N-CONNECTA AMT7,80,000
TEKNA AMT8,49,000

Design and Inspiration

The All-New Gravite establishes a bold and distinct identity aligned with Nissan’s global design language. Its signature C-shaped front grille—a defining element of Nissan’s DNA—ensures instant recognition and a bold on-road presence. The Gravite’s sleek horizontal proportions and confident, muscular stance combine modern elegance with practical and everyday usability.

The Gravite is the only vehicle in its segment to feature distinctive hood branding along with unique rear-door badging—a bold design choice that powerfully amplifies its exclusive identity. The rear fascia continues to echo Nissan’s signature C-shaped interlock theme, ensuring the MPV’s unmistakable presence on every road.

Building on this momentum, the Nissan Magnite continues to strengthen the brand’s global footprint as one of its most successful ‘Made in India’ models. Now exported to 65 markets across South Asia, the Middle East, Africa, and Latin America, the Magnite’s strong acceptance underscores India’s pivotal role as a manufacturing and export hub for Nissan.

Further strengthening its future-ready product roadmap in India, Nissan revealed the Tekton in October 2025—its upcoming premium SUV.
